// Return path of this executable
std::string rocsparse_exepath()
{
    std::string pathstr;
    char*       path = realpath("/proc/self/exe", 0);
    if(path)
    {
        char* p = strrchr(path, '/');
        if(p)
        {
            p[1]    = 0;
            pathstr = path;
        }
        free(path);
    }
    return pathstr;
}

/*  timing:*/

/*! \brief  CPU Timer(in microsecond): synchronize with the default device and return wall time */
double get_time_us(void)
{
    hipDeviceSynchronize();
    struct timeval tv;
    gettimeofday(&tv, NULL);
    return (tv.tv_sec * 1000 * 1000) + tv.tv_usec;
};

/*! \brief  CPU Timer(in microsecond): synchronize with given queue/stream and return wall time */
double get_time_us_sync(hipStream_t stream)
{
    hipStreamSynchronize(stream);
    struct timeval tv;
    gettimeofday(&tv, NULL);
    return (tv.tv_sec * 1000 * 1000) + tv.tv_usec;
};
